Synthesis of p-Sulphonamidobenzenediazoaminoazobenzene and Its Colour Reaction with Cadmium

Abstract

A new triazene reagent,p-sulphonamidobenzenediazoaminoazobenzene(p-SADAA),was synthesized,and its color reaction with cadmium was studied.In pH 11.26 NH 4Cl-NH 3·H 2O buffer solution with the presence of nonionic surfactant OP,p-SADAA reacts with cadmium to form a 3∶1 stable complex with the maximum absorption wavelength of 510nm,and apparent molar absorptivity of 1.23×10 5L·mol -1·cm -1.Beer's law is obeyed for cadmium in the range of 0—10.67μg/25mL.The method was applied to the determination of trace cadmium in industrial wastewater with satisfactory results.
